How it calculates
To calculate the area (A) and perimeter (P) of a regular octagon, the following formulas are used:
Area: A = 2 × (1 + √2) × s²
Perimeter: P = 8 × s
In these formulas, 's' represents the length of one side of the octagon. The area formula derives from the fact that a regular octagon can be divided into eight isosceles triangles, each having a vertex angle of 45 degrees. The perimeter formula is straightforward, as it simply involves multiplying the length of one side by the total number of sides, which is eight. Both calculations assume the octagon is regular, meaning all sides and angles are equal, ensuring that the results are accurate given the input.

Worked examples
Example 1: An architect wishes to calculate the area of a regular octagon with a side length of 5 meters. Using the area formula: A = 2 × (1 + √2) × s² A = 2 × (1 + √2) × (5)² A = 2 × (1 + 1.414) × 25 A ≈ 2 × 2.414 × 25 A ≈ 120.7 square meters.
Example 2: A landscape designer needs to find the perimeter of a regular octagon with a side length of 3 feet. Using the perimeter formula: P = 8 × s P = 8 × 3 P = 24 feet. This perimeter will help in estimating the amount of edging needed around the garden bed.

FAQs
Q: How does the area formula for a regular octagon relate to its side length? A: The area formula A = 2 × (1 + √2) × s² illustrates that the area increases with the square of the side length, emphasizing the quadratic relationship between side length and area.
Q: What happens to the properties of a regular octagon if it becomes irregular? A: If an octagon is irregular, the side lengths and angles are not equal, leading to different calculations for area and perimeter, which would require different approaches.
Q: Can this calculator handle non-standard units of measurement? A: The calculator is designed for standard units (e.g., meters, feet). Users must ensure consistent units for accurate results, as mixing units can lead to incorrect calculations.
Q: Why is the angle of a regular octagon always 135 degrees? A: The internal angle of a regular octagon is calculated using the formula (n-2) × 180° ÷ n, where n is the number of sides. For an octagon, this results in (8-2) × 180° ÷ 8 = 135°.
